Bellellen · Suburb / Locality
Work across the area — who is in the labour force, in which industries and jobs.
Far fewer adults are working or looking for work in Bellellen than in most similar areas. Only 47.4% of adults are in the labour force, though the unemployment rate is a remarkably low 0.0%.
Employment, participation and unemployment.
The number of adults working or looking for work is far below the Victorian figure of 62.4%. Full-time employment is also much lower than most areas at 29.6%, which is about 30 points below the state average.

The industries that employ local workers.
Employment is spread across several sectors, with education and training being the most common at 25.9%. Agriculture, construction, and health care each account for 18.5% of the workforce.
The kinds of jobs people do.
Professionals make up the largest group of workers at 37.0%. Other common roles include technicians and trades at 14.8%, while managers, clerical staff, and sales workers each represent 11.1% of the workforce.
